Your Home Is an Electrical System Too

The exhibition gets even more relatable with a Living Room, Bedroom and Kitchen electrical display.

Instead of talking about electricity only through substations and transmission lines, this section brings the subject directly into the home.

It demonstrates 6A and 16A sockets and switches, MCBs, RCCBs, single-phase and three-phase energy meters, single-phase preventers, earthing and other electrical protection systems.

This raises an important question:

Is your home's electrical system designed for the way you use electricity today?

A home that once had a fan, a few lights and a television may now have air conditioners, geysers, washing machines, induction cooktops, microwave ovens, refrigerators, chargers and several other high-load appliances.

That means household wiring and protection systems matter more than ever.

The right electrical system is not a luxury. It is a basic part of household safety.

Government Free Power Schemes: A Benefit Comes With Responsibility

For consumers looking for information about government free electricity schemes in Telangana, this is one of the most relevant sections of the exhibition.

The display highlights several government-supported electricity benefits, including Gruha Jyothi, free power for eligible educational institutions, free power for eligible salons and laundries, and 24/7 free power supply to agriculture.

Gruha Jyothi Scheme Telangana

The Gruha Jyothi Scheme provides eligible domestic households with free electricity consumption up to 200 units per month.

Eligible household benefit

Up to 200 Units / Month

Free Power for Agriculture

Telangana's power-sector programmes also include 24-hour free power supply to agriculture pump sets, supporting agricultural consumers as part of the state's electricity policy.

Free Electricity for Salons and Laundries

Eligible hair-cutting salons, laundry shops and dhobi ghats can also receive electricity support under applicable state schemes.

Cybersecurity: Electricity Fraud Is Now a Digital Problem Too

The modern electricity consumer doesn't only need electrical awareness. They need digital awareness.

Fake power-bill messages. Fake disconnection threats. Fake payment links. Fraudulent calls. Requests for OTPs. Requests for bank information.

The exhibition's IT and cybersecurity messaging is therefore increasingly relevant to ordinary consumers.

Never let urgency override verification.

A message claiming that your power will be disconnected in a few minutes is exactly the kind of message designed to make people act without thinking.

Pause. Verify the source. Use official TGSPDCL channels. Never share OTPs or banking credentials.

Rooftop Solar: From Electricity Consumer to Energy Participant

The renewable-energy section takes the conversation beyond simply consuming electricity.

With rooftop solar and net metering, a home can potentially become both a consumer and a generator of electricity under applicable rules.

Traditional model Emerging model
Utility → Consumer Consumer ↔ Grid

For consumers researching rooftop solar in Telangana, TGSPDCL net metering or the PM Surya Ghar Muft Bijli Yojana, this is an especially relevant part of the exhibition.

But solar should be approached with realistic expectations. A rooftop solar system does not automatically mean a zero bill in every household.

The actual outcome depends on consumption, system capacity, rooftop conditions, generation, applicable subsidy and net-metering arrangements.
